This hack has actually been around for a long time, but it just keeps getting more and more popular. And the reason why is because apparently, the crispy crunch of a bell pepper goes perfectly with sandwich ingredients like turkey, lettuce, and mustard. And of course, it's a lower carb option than eating all that bread.

But I'm pretty skeptical about this. To me, a sandwich is all about the bread. That'd be like having cereal with no milk, or peanut butter with no jelly, or my face with no mustache. But let's give it a go anyway.

So to make this, we're gonna cut the top and bottom off of a bell pepper. Then, cut it right down the middle and remove the white part in the center with all those seeds. Once we have our bell pepper bread ready to go, we can fill this with any ingredients we want. I'm gonna use the toppings that I keep seeing the most on TikTok, which is cream cheese, followed by lettuce, then some turkey-- I use vegan turkey since I'm vegetarian-- then cheese, and then a little bit of mustard to top it all off because it is supposed to be a sandwich, after all.

Time for our big old, crispy, crunchy, low-carb bell pepper sandwich. Mmm. Mmm. That's really good, to be honest. I'm kind of surprised. The flavor does go really well together. The crisp and crunch actually adds another element to the sandwich. And of course, it's all about the ingredients you put on there in the first place.

My only downside would be that I don't know if I can eat a whole one of these things. It's a lot of bell pepper to bite through. But on first bite, it's pretty yummy. I'll give it a four out of five.

Next up, Snapability. So these things definitely look pretty weird. The only downside I have for posting a Snap story is it's hard to keep these things together. They fall apart right after you take a bite out of them.

So if you're gonna post them, I would do it before you eat anything in them. That said, they look way crazier than a regular sandwich, with like the crazy colors from a bell pepper. So I'm gonna give it a four out of five as well for Snapability.
